WebThe speaker is able to see the beauty and romance in the simplicity of standing at the curb with her husband and their recycling bins, looking up at Orion, but her husband expresses a desire to know more beyond this tiny snippet of knowledge. Webby Ada Limón Buy Study Guide Dead Stars Character List The speaker Physically, the first-person speaker of this poem is taking out the trash and recycling to the street and looking at the night sky. Mentally, she begins thinking deeply about how humans can embody our highest potential for goodness. marcelo rossato https://westcountypool.com

A quintessential Ada Limón poem, this, from 2024’s The Carrying: it blends the small and everyday (taking out the trash bins) with the vast and cosmological (the speaker muses on the fact that we are all stardust, since every atom in our bodies was once part of some long-dead star). Web"Dead Stars," the poem's title, has multiple meanings: first, that our bodies are comprised of elements that used to make up long-dead stars. Second, it calls to mind the …
